Examples of fun fact questions

  • Who did you look up to as a child?
  • What is your favourite hobby?
  • If you could go anywhere in the world, where would it be?
  • If you could only eat one type of food for the rest of your life, what would it be?
  • Do you have any hidden talents?
  • What is your favourite childhood memory?

What are good fun facts about yourself for work?

Fun ‘facts about me’: what you love and hate

  • The TV show you binge over and over (…and over) again.
  • Your most-prized recent purchase.
  • Your go-to karaoke song.
  • The movie you’ve seen dozens of times.
  • Similarly, the book you’ve read dozens of times.
  • Something you can’t live without.
  • Your strangest food preferences.

Is it good to tell people fun facts about yourself?

Whether you’re at a party, on a date, in a job interview, or just meeting someone new for the first time, revealing some fun facts about yourself can be a great icebreaker. When you tell people these interesting tidbits of information, you become more human and more likeable.

What’s the best definition of a fun fact?

The ideal fun fact is two things: (1) interesting enough to ensure nobody makes you do it over, and (2) not so interesting that everyone has lots of follow-up questions. It doesn’t have to be fun. It will rarely be fun.
